Course content
1. Short presentation of a technical material and a discussion 2. Discussion of the used grammatical and spelling phrases 3. Reading of technical literature and a brief summary writing 4. Advanced grammar, typical mistakes, czenglish

Learning activities and teaching methods
Dialogic Lecture (Discussion, Dialog, Brainstorming)
Learning outcomes
The aim of the course is to further develop the basic and academic knowledge of the language for the needs of future experts in computer science. The course focuses on the development of the presentation skills and on the understanding of technical materials in both written and oral forms.
